logo

Output 0ab95586090902aca7309f372d240a07b0d80719f4541e996c82a518cf06d51f:1

value
21428727
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ba860884e6b27bf195ded0dedfa6a6a14e3ec42c OP_EQUALVERIFY OP_CHECKSIG
address
1J1FFUbqFejXLaM4CWRNikWeTbUH9cUmiW
transaction
0ab95586090902aca7309f372d240a07b0d80719f4541e996c82a518cf06d51f